What Are the Ingredients for Caprese Salad?
Caprese salad is made with just three basic ingredientstomatoes, fresh basil, and fresh mozzarella.

How Far Ahead Can You Make Caprese Salad?
Make Caprese salad just before you plan to serve it.
Tomatoes can become mealy and lose their flavor if refrigerated for too long.

Assemble the salad by arranging alternating slices of tomatoes, basil leaves, and mozzarella slices.
Drizzle extra virgin olive oil over the salad.
Add a dash of balsamic vinegar, if using.
Sprinkle lightly with pepper.
